How do we handle radio button in Webdynpro?

But these are the 3 preperties maily used in case of radiobutton.
KeyToSelect: Unique key which which this radio button will be identified while selection from a number of radiobutton.s
SelectedKey: This property is set to the key of the radiobutton that is currently selected.
OnSelect: An event that you want to fire when the radio button is selected.
Assume you have 2 radio button RB1 and RB2
<b>Properties of RB1</b>
KeyToSelect: Key_1
SelectedKey: context attribute (Ctx_SelectedKey) type String
OnSelect: Action1
<b>Properties of RB2</b>
KeyToSelect: Key_2
SelectedKey: context attribute (Ctx_SelectedKey) type String
OnSelect: Action2
Note: selectedKey is binded to the same context as you want to consider them as a single group.
If you want to set that RB1 should be selected by default when the application is executed.
you can write this in wdDoInit()
wdContext.currentContextElement().setCtx_SelectedKey("Key_1");
